A calling agency has data showing that the average response time is 5.6 minutes with a standard deviation of 1.8.The manager wants to know how much time is required for 75% of all calls to be handled(in other words,the value below which 3/4 of response times fall). First find the Z-score and then use the Z-score formula,but solve for X given a particular value of Z)
